The FloPlast Xtraflo Industrial Gutter Stopend Outlet is an essential component for commercial or heavy-duty residential drainage systems, specifically designed for those needing a robust connection between guttering and a 110mm downpipe while simultaneously sealing the gutter run. This two-part fitting provides a secure, industrial-grade solution that installs directly onto the fascia, offering excellent durability and reliability. However, users should note that successful installation requires the use of a lubricant on seals to ensure a completely watertight fit, which may require an additional purchase if not already on hand.

FAQs

Is the SL40 silicon spray included in the box?

No, the SL40 silicon spray is a recommended accessory that must be purchased separately to ensure the seals are lubricated correctly.

Can this be used on standard domestic guttering?

No, this is part of the Xtraflo industrial range and is only compatible with Xtraflo guttering components.

Does this product seal the end of the gutter automatically?

Yes, it acts as a stopend, effectively capping off the gutter run while providing the necessary outlet for the downpipe.

What size downpipe does this connect to?

This unit is designed specifically to connect to a 110mm downpipe.

How do I secure it to the building?

It features integrated moulded screwholes, allowing you to screw it directly onto the fascia board for a permanent, secure fit.

Troubleshooting

The connection feels stiff when pushing the downpipe into the outlet

Apply a generous amount of SL40 silicon spray to the internal seals and ensure the pipe end is chamfered slightly for easier entry.

Water is leaking from the junction between the outlet and the gutter

Verify that the seal is seated correctly and that the unit is securely screwed into the fascia board, ensuring the gutter has not shifted.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Installation requires standard trade tools, including a drill for the fascia fixings and a level to ensure the correct fall for water drainage. Always ensure the gutter is clean and free of debris before attaching the stopend. This product is exclusively designed for the FloPlast Xtraflo system; do not attempt to use it with standard domestic 112mm or 114mm half-round systems, as the profiles will not match. To maintain the system, periodically inspect the seals for signs of aging and remove any leaf matter or moss from the gutter interior to prevent blockages that could stress the joint.
